Deb's Artisan Bakehouse is a charming bakery located at 402 West Green Street in Middletown, Maryland. As a renowned institution in the area, Deb's Artisan Bakehouse offers a wide variety of freshly baked artisanal goods, including breads, pastries, cakes, and cookies. Customers can also find a selection of gourmet foods and specialty items at this cozy store. Whether you're looking for a delicious treat to enjoy with your morning coffee or a unique gift for a loved one, Deb's Artisan Bakehouse has something for everyone. "TLDR: Amazing small batch bakery offering both sweet and savory baked goodies. Come early or call ahead because very limited amounts of each pastry are made each day. Come for the quiches and savory croissants! Vibe: 3/5. Located on a small side street in the quaint town of Middletown, Deb's bakery is a pickup counter only bakery. The shop has a handful of parking spots in front as well as ample street parking nearby. The storefront is very small, so Deb's only allows 5 people at a time inside the building. The interior is very utilitarian by design. Baking sheet racks and ingredients overflow into the storefront area as well as call in orders line the adjacent wall shelving. Front and center in the shop is the display case which shows what's available for the day. Once you get to the front of the line, you can gaze over the bountiful array of baked goods before telling the staff what you want. It truly is the most visually striking piece of the bakery. Service: 5/5. Even with how busy the store was during our visit, the staff at Deb's did a great job at making sure every customer leaves with a smile on their face. We arrived at 9:45am on a Saturday (they open at 9:30am) and the line had already formed outside the store. Once in line, Deb's staff did a great job ushering new customers inside the bakery as others left. For orders placed in advance over the phone, the staff would bring the orders out to customers waiting in their cars up front so not to further congest the line. After 10-15 minutes of queuing, we made it to the front of the bakery counter to make our choices and what appeared to be the owner Deb was very helpful in making our choices. It was out first time, so she gave us some good recommendations based off of her favorites as well as what items typically sell out. Everything was then boxed up nice and neatly and we're given instructions for reheating and storing if not eaten immediately. All in all, stellar service from start to finish! Food: 5/5. Unbelievable pastries that rival some items I have had at posh NYC bakeries. It is incredibly hard to choose only a few items to try at Deb's, but we managed to settle on a Reuben crossoint, a bacon, egg and gruyere quiche and brown sugar banana Biscoff pastry. Each item was absolutely delicious in their own rights, but the quiche took best in show. We were told when ordering that it's one of the fastest selling items on their menu and we could definitely see why. The quiche stands around 2 inches in height and the size of a bar napkin. The quiche egg are incredibly fluffy (think French scrambled eggs fluffy) and perfectly balanced with the smokey/saltiness of the bacon. The gruyere rounds off the flavor profile with a nice creaminess that goes well with the hearty baked crust. The Reuben crossoint did not disappoint either. The light airy layers of the fresh baked crossoint was the perfect vehicle for the rich and hearty swiss and pastrami. Finally, the sweet brown sugar banana Biscoff was the epitomy of decadence. The over ripe bananas, similar to what you find in banana cream pie, brought serious flavor to the whippy toasted meringue topping and flaky crust. Like the quiche, our serving towered in at 2 inches in height and the size of a bar napkin. Overall, we loved everything we tried at Deb's. With each item ringing in at around $15, on paper this would be considered a pricey splurge. However, when you see how generous the portions are, you will be quick to spend a cool $50+ on some of the best baked goods on this side of the Mason Dixon"
